
Kaelem contributed to srl-labs/containerlab by engineering features and fixes that enhanced network automation, configuration management, and developer experience. Over 11 months, Kaelem delivered robust solutions such as automated configuration generation for SR-SIM components, flexible startup workflows for Cisco IOL nodes, and extensible topology modeling with YAML schema definitions. Using Go, Shell scripting, and YAML, Kaelem improved deployment reliability, streamlined onboarding through detailed documentation, and introduced accessibility enhancements like a braille-based logo. The work addressed real-world challenges in container orchestration and network emulation, demonstrating depth in backend development, DevOps automation, and cross-platform usability within a complex, evolving codebase.
February 2026 (2026-02) performance highlights for srl-labs/containerlab centered on reliability, accessibility, and code quality. The team delivered targeted fixes and a branding enhancement that together improve operational readiness and inclusivity for end users.
February 2026 (2026-02) performance highlights for srl-labs/containerlab centered on reliability, accessibility, and code quality. The team delivered targeted fixes and a branding enhancement that together improve operational readiness and inclusivity for end users.
November 2025 (2025-11): Focused on improving SR-SIM observability, reliability, and network correctness within srl-labs/containerlab. Delivered container labeling to identify SR-SIM root nodes, addressed a critical networking offload issue, and hardened interface enumeration to tolerate partial failures. These changes reduce mean time to diagnose issues, improve scalability for distributed SR-SIM topologies, and strengthen overall deployment stability. Technologies demonstrated include container orchestration visibility, Linux networking (veth), TX checksum offload considerations, and robust error handling, with clear commit traceability across changes.
November 2025 (2025-11): Focused on improving SR-SIM observability, reliability, and network correctness within srl-labs/containerlab. Delivered container labeling to identify SR-SIM root nodes, addressed a critical networking offload issue, and hardened interface enumeration to tolerate partial failures. These changes reduce mean time to diagnose issues, improve scalability for distributed SR-SIM topologies, and strengthen overall deployment stability. Technologies demonstrated include container orchestration visibility, Linux networking (veth), TX checksum offload considerations, and robust error handling, with clear commit traceability across changes.
October 2025 monthly summary for srl-labs/containerlab focusing on delivering automated SR-SIM configuration generation, robust startup/deployment handling, post-deployment monitoring, and clearer IP management to improve provisioning reliability and observability.
October 2025 monthly summary for srl-labs/containerlab focusing on delivering automated SR-SIM configuration generation, robust startup/deployment handling, post-deployment monitoring, and clearer IP management to improve provisioning reliability and observability.
Concise monthly summary for 2025-09 focusing on business value and technical accomplishments across the srl-labs/containerlab repo. Highlights include branding and repository structure improvements, substantial SR-SIM component enhancements, and topology modeling enhancements that improve deployment reliability and automation.
Concise monthly summary for 2025-09 focusing on business value and technical accomplishments across the srl-labs/containerlab repo. Highlights include branding and repository structure improvements, substantial SR-SIM component enhancements, and topology modeling enhancements that improve deployment reliability and automation.
2025-08 Monthly Summary for srl-labs/containerlab: Delivered two key features that enhance observability and provider extensibility. Key features: integration of Wireshark capture in the Containerlab VS Code extension with user-facing guidance and a VNC-streamed capture container (commit 053446ce2d1324b11c1205cbe13d2fa4773001d4). Added N9KV provider schema (n9kv.yaml) to lay groundwork for N9KV support (commit d61a2f92fc2e9768d727aaf9bcf78024192e873b). Major bugs fixed: none reported this month. Overall impact: Accelerates troubleshooting, simplifies local capture workflows, and expands provider ecosystem readiness. Technologies/skills demonstrated: VS Code extension development, containerized capture via VNC, YAML schema design for provider definitions, documentation and UX improvements.
2025-08 Monthly Summary for srl-labs/containerlab: Delivered two key features that enhance observability and provider extensibility. Key features: integration of Wireshark capture in the Containerlab VS Code extension with user-facing guidance and a VNC-streamed capture container (commit 053446ce2d1324b11c1205cbe13d2fa4773001d4). Added N9KV provider schema (n9kv.yaml) to lay groundwork for N9KV support (commit d61a2f92fc2e9768d727aaf9bcf78024192e873b). Major bugs fixed: none reported this month. Overall impact: Accelerates troubleshooting, simplifies local capture workflows, and expands provider ecosystem readiness. Technologies/skills demonstrated: VS Code extension development, containerized capture via VNC, YAML schema design for provider definitions, documentation and UX improvements.
Delivered four targeted improvements and fixes in 2025-07 for srl-labs/containerlab, focusing on automation, reliability, and UX. Implemented machine-readable CSV export for container inspection, introduced a multi-node 'groups' feature with inheritance to simplify topology management, added real-time Docker image pull progress feedback, and fixed Fedora 42 installation in the quick-install script. These changes reduce manual configuration, improve cross-environment reliability, and enhance user feedback during long-running operations.
Delivered four targeted improvements and fixes in 2025-07 for srl-labs/containerlab, focusing on automation, reliability, and UX. Implemented machine-readable CSV export for container inspection, introduced a multi-node 'groups' feature with inheritance to simplify topology management, added real-time Docker image pull progress feedback, and fixed Fedora 42 installation in the quick-install script. These changes reduce manual configuration, improve cross-environment reliability, and enhance user feedback during long-running operations.
Month: 2025-04. Focused on expanding configurability and user guidance for the containerlab VS Code extension. Key deliverable: a new Telnet port configuration option (containerlab.node.telnetPort) documented in the extension docs, enabling users to specify the Telnet port when connecting to containers. This aligns with improving flexibility in container access and onboarding for Telnet-based workflows. No major bugs were reported this month; effort concentrated on design, documentation, and safe deployment of the new setting.
Month: 2025-04. Focused on expanding configurability and user guidance for the containerlab VS Code extension. Key deliverable: a new Telnet port configuration option (containerlab.node.telnetPort) documented in the extension docs, enabling users to specify the Telnet port when connecting to containers. This aligns with improving flexibility in container access and onboarding for Telnet-based workflows. No major bugs were reported this month; effort concentrated on design, documentation, and safe deployment of the new setting.
March 2025 monthly summary: Delivered targeted documentation enhancements for Containerlab to improve cross-platform onboarding and DevPod integration. The updates reduce setup friction for Windows/WSL users and clarify VS Code extension configuration, enabling faster adoption and smoother development workflows.
March 2025 monthly summary: Delivered targeted documentation enhancements for Containerlab to improve cross-platform onboarding and DevPod integration. The updates reduce setup friction for Windows/WSL users and clarify VS Code extension configuration, enabling faster adoption and smoother development workflows.
February 2025 summary for srl-labs/containerlab focused on developer experience enhancements and security automation to accelerate safe lab deployments. Key work includes comprehensive documentation for the Containerlab VS Code extension and automated admin provisioning during quick setup, enabling faster onboarding and reduced manual steps.
February 2025 summary for srl-labs/containerlab focused on developer experience enhancements and security automation to accelerate safe lab deployments. Key work includes comprehensive documentation for the Containerlab VS Code extension and automated admin provisioning during quick setup, enabling faster onboarding and reduced manual steps.
January 2025 performance focused on strengthening Cisco IOL support in containerlab and cleaning up documentation to prevent misconfigurations. Delivered targeted interface naming validation, improved IOL node mapping, introduced persistent configuration for Cisco IOL devices, and corrected startup example naming to reflect the true IOL node kind. These changes reduce operator error, streamline configuration workflows, and enhance deployment reliability across the repo srl-labs/containerlab.
January 2025 performance focused on strengthening Cisco IOL support in containerlab and cleaning up documentation to prevent misconfigurations. Delivered targeted interface naming validation, improved IOL node mapping, introduced persistent configuration for Cisco IOL devices, and corrected startup example naming to reflect the true IOL node kind. These changes reduce operator error, streamline configuration workflows, and enhance deployment reliability across the repo srl-labs/containerlab.
December 2024—Container Lab (srl-labs/containerlab) Key features delivered: - Cisco IOL node startup configuration and management interface updates: added flexible startup configuration options (full or partial) to be applied on first boot; refined subsequent-boot management interface IP updates to improve network stability. Major bugs fixed: - Fixed management interface and startup configs for IOL (#2347), addressing boot-time configuration reliability and reducing manual remediation. Overall impact and accomplishments: - Improved automation reliability for Cisco IOL node deployments, enabling deterministic startup behavior, more stable network configurations across reboots, and faster lab provisioning with fewer incidents during initial boot sequences. Technologies/skills demonstrated: - Networking automation, Cisco IOL provisioning, containerlab workflow enhancements, configuration management, version control traceability, and robust debugging. Commit references: - 3581550a8ded3d136c9cc656b71bc6599bb9b703
December 2024—Container Lab (srl-labs/containerlab) Key features delivered: - Cisco IOL node startup configuration and management interface updates: added flexible startup configuration options (full or partial) to be applied on first boot; refined subsequent-boot management interface IP updates to improve network stability. Major bugs fixed: - Fixed management interface and startup configs for IOL (#2347), addressing boot-time configuration reliability and reducing manual remediation. Overall impact and accomplishments: - Improved automation reliability for Cisco IOL node deployments, enabling deterministic startup behavior, more stable network configurations across reboots, and faster lab provisioning with fewer incidents during initial boot sequences. Technologies/skills demonstrated: - Networking automation, Cisco IOL provisioning, containerlab workflow enhancements, configuration management, version control traceability, and robust debugging. Commit references: - 3581550a8ded3d136c9cc656b71bc6599bb9b703

Overview of all repositories you've contributed to across your timeline